As noted before, Warner Bros Discovery officials recently lifted their ban on the Briscoes Brothers not being allowed to make appearances on AEW programming on their networks. This ban was originally believed to be due to WBD officials issues with past homophobic comments made by the late Jay Briscoe.
Dave Meltzer reported in this week’s Wrestling Observer Newsletter that his sources stated that there was a second big reason for WBD’s recent ban against the Briscoes. Those spoken to reportedly stated that this was due to WBD officials being uncomfortable with the Briscoes’ past usage of the Confederate flag on their entrance jackets and ring gear for their matches.
This flag has been a source of longtime controversy in the United States, most recently involving the removal of Confederate statues over the view that they glorify slavery, racism, white supremacy, segregation, and other controversial issues.
